Understanding Automated Genome Assembly Robots
Automated Genome Assembly Robots are pivotal in advancing genetic research and biotechnology. These systems provide benefits that are reshaping current practices in genome assembly.
High Precision: Automated robots minimize human error during DNA assembly, leading to more reliable genomic data and insights crucial for research.
Increased Throughput: These systems can process multiple samples simultaneously, drastically reducing the time needed for genome sequencing and allowing for more extensive studies.
Cost Efficiency: By automating the genome assembly process, laboratories can save valuable resources, enabling them to allocate budgets towards additional research and innovation.
Standardization: Automated protocols assure consistent and reproducible results, which is essential for collaborative projects and regulatory compliance.
Integration: Many robots can easily interface with other lab technologies, facilitating a seamless workflow in genomic research processes.
Advancements in Synthetic Biology: These robots enable researchers to design and construct complex biological systems, propelling biotechnology into new frontiers.
